Postpartum hair loss can make new mothers feel anxious and less confident — but it’s a completely natural part of recovery. As your body rebalances hormones, many hair strands shift into the shedding phase.

Simple rituals can enhance results:
- Massage your scalp for 3–5 minutes to boost circulation.
- Use lukewarm water — not hot — to protect fragile follicles.
- Pair your shampoo routine with a nutrient-rich diet and hydration.
- Incorporate rest and mindful breathing to regulate stress hormones.

Nourish the Mind as You Nourish Your Hair
Emotional health deeply influences physical recovery. Stress and sleep deprivation can raise cortisol levels, disrupting the hair cycle.
Taking mindful moments each day — gentle breathing, scalp massage, or gratitude journaling — can meaningfully support your body’s healing rhythm.
